If the Administration receive information that an inmate or group of inmates is carrying out illegal behaviour (such as brewing "hooch", or making weapons) then officers will shakedown individual cells without searching everywhere else.

Shakedowns take manpower that some units find difficult to cover, so daily shakedowns would be unusual unless an inmate was blatantly misbehaving. Those inmates would be likely to be moved to Ad Seg temporarily so that they had less property and less opportunity to break the rules.
